IPL 2013 preview: Delhi Daredevils still in search of first win

Delhi Daredevils will look to register their first win when they take on RCB today.

Delhi Daredevils will look to register their first win when they take on the dangerous Royal Challengers Bangalore in Bangalore today.

We are in the third week of the tournament and the Delhi franchise is yet to open their account. Touted to be a major title contender this season,the team has failed to put up a good show in their previous fixtures.

It will now be a difficult journey up the points table as the Mahela Jayawardene-led unit will now have to win a lot of games from here on. There is no scope for complacency,and the team will have to step up their game.

Pace vs Spin

It will be a good contest between the Delhi seamers and Bangalore spinners. Delhi boast a formidable pace heavy line-up,led by the lanky Morne Morkel. Bangalore,on the other hand,have a lot of variety in their ranks,and the two Muralis (Murali Kartik and Muttiah Muralitharan) possess enough skill to outclass any opponent.

Virender Sehwag. Will he fire?

Delhi desperately want fit-again Sehwag to fire today,and solve their opening miseries. The right-hander,along with the belligerent Warner,can tear any attack apart. In such desperate times,the opener will have to get his act right and give his team a much-needed push.

Battle of the Delhi boys

The very intense Virat Kohli will be up against some of his former state teammates (Virender Sehwag,Ashish Nehra and Unmukt Chand). Get your coke and popcorn ready,an exciting face-off on the cards.
